
- Determine the surface area of the right square pyramid.

The formula for finding the surface area of a right square pyramid is ⇨ b² + 2bl, where
- b = base of the right square pyramid
- l = slant height of the right square pyramid.
In the given figure,
- base (b) = 4 ft.
- slant height (l) = 8 ft.
Now, let's substitute the values of b & l in the formula & solve it :-

So, the surface area of the right square pyramid is <u>8</u><u>0</u><u> </u><u>ft²</u><u>.</u>
